Downer Avenue Pumpkin Carving Contest

Downer Avenue businesses show off their pumpkin prowess!

Milwaukee, WI – The Downer Avenue Business Improvement Districts (BID) will host a Pumpkin Carving Contest October 24th through the 31st. Several businesses in the BID will display pumpkins carved by their staff in their storefronts. Shoppers and visitors will find posters displayed in each storefront with a QR code that will direct to page where you can vote for your favorite works of carved creativity. You can vote for your favorite Downer Avenue pumpkins until 11:59pm on October 31. The winner will be announced on November 1st.
